The Customs Department at Delhi Airport recently arrested two individuals in a case of gold smuggling. One of the accused claimed to be the personal assistant (PA) to Congress MP Shashi Tharoor. Agents discovered approximately 500 grams of gold in their possession. Shashi Tharoor, however, quickly clarified that the individual caught is not currently employed by him.

According to a news agency, the Delhi Customs Department conducted a search of two people at Delhi Airport on May 29. The search led to the discovery of roughly 500 grams of gold. One of the individuals was identified as Shiv Kumar, who professed to be the PA of Shashi Tharoor. The custom officials are further interrogating the accused.

The Customs Department also released a statement on the case, registering a case of gold smuggling against an individual based on suspicion at the IGI Airport. The accused arrived from Bangkok to Delhi via flight TG-323 on May 29. During the investigation, another individual was also found involved. He had come to the airport to receive the passenger and was also aiding in the smuggling. A gold chain weighing 500 grams was recovered, with an estimated value of 35.22 lakh rupees. The circumstances surrounding the acquisition of the valid aerodrome entry permit by the accused, who was part of the parliament member's protocol team, are being scrutinized.

The Accused Worked Part-Time: Tharoor

Meanwhile, Shashi Tharoor took to social media platform X to issue a clarification. Tharoor expressed his shock upon hearing about the incident linked to a former staff member. He stated that the caught individual had been employed part-time as an airport facility assistant.

'I Do Not Support Wrongdoings'

Shashi Tharoor continued regarding the individual detained at Delhi Airport, 'He is a 72-year-old retired person who regularly undergoes dialysis. The accused was engaged on a compassionate part-time basis. I do not support any wrongdoings and fully back the efforts of the authorities to take necessary actions for the investigation of this matter. Let the law take its course.'
